İnsanların bir web sayfasında "Yazdır" yazan bir bağlantı veya düğme aramak zorunda olmaları beni şaşırtmıyor, özellikle de bu adımı gereksiz kılan mucize bir teknoloji olduğu düşünüldüğünde. Ne yazık ki 10 yaşında olmasına rağmen neredeyse hiç kimse kullanmıyor.
Baskı için fazladan bir adım gerektirmek aptalca olmakla kalmaz, aynı zamanda baskı stil sayfalarının kullanılması, yazdırılabilir bağlantıyı kullanmayanlar için biraz mürekkep tasarrufu sağlar. Ve elbette, makaleleri daha sonra kağıt israf etmeden kaydetmek için PDF'ye yazdır kullanan birçok kişi var.
Yazdırma Stil Sayfaları Nedir?
Çoğu web sitesi, sizi yazıcılar için farklı biçimlendirilmiş başka bir sayfaya götürerek yazdırma işlevini uygular - ancak bu gerçekten gerekli değildir. Her tarayıcı, şu adıyla bilinen basit bir CSS teknolojisini kullanır: Stil Sayfalarını Yazdır , tarayıcınız sayfayı yazdırdığında gizlenecek öğeleri belirten bir dosyadan başka bir şey değildir.
Tanıdık olmayanlar için CSS, Basamaklı Stil Sayfaları anlamına gelir ve tarayıcınız, bir web sayfasının HTML kaynak kodunu ekranda gerçekte gördüğünüz şekilde nasıl biçimlendireceğini bilir. Yazı tiplerinden, renklerden, kenarlıklardan ve hatta arka plan görüntülerinden her şey stil sayfasında belirtilebilir.
Bir baskı stil sayfası eklemek, bu tek satırı sayfanızın HTML'sine eklemek kadar basittir — kodun media = yazdırma kısmı, tarayıcıya yazdırırken yalnızca bu stil sayfasını kullanmasını söyler.
<link rel = ”stylesheet” href = ”print.css” type = ”text / css” media = ”print”>
Bu dosya genel olarak şuna benzer:
#sidebar, #footer, #navigation, #sharinglinks, #topad, #yorumlar { display:none }
Evet, gerçekten bu kadar basit. Peki nasıl çalışıyor? Aşağıda, tüm gezinme, logo ve reklamların ilişkilendirilmiş kimlikle açıkça görülebildiği, solda ise tüm bu öğeleri gizleyen baskı stil sayfasının uygulandığı aynı sayfanın olduğu normal bir web sayfası örneği verilmiştir.
Açıkçası bunlardan birini diğerinin üzerine yazdırmayı tercih edersiniz, değil mi?
Yazdırma Stil Sayfası Hatası Örnekleri
Ne yazık ki, bunu uygulama zahmetine girmemiş çok sayıda büyük web sitesi var. New York Times'tan baskı almaya çalıştığınızda ne olduğuna bir bakın:
Gawker site ağı gibi bazı siteler daha da kötüdür. Yazdırılabilir bir görünümü olmadığı gibi, denediğinizde ve yazdırdığınızda mürekkep çorbasına benziyor. Anlayabildiğimiz kadarıyla, bir Gawker sitesinden Okunabilirlik gibi ayrı bir hizmet kullanmadan veya sayfadaki içeriği manuel olarak vurgulamadan yazdırmanın bir yolu yoktur, ki bu yeni tasarımlarında neredeyse imkansızdır.
Gerçekten üzücü. En büyük sitelerin yükleri, bu özelliği uygulama zahmetinde tamamen başarısız oluyor.
Neyse ki, Bazı Siteler Bunları Kullanıyor
Aşağıda, yazdırma bağlantısını bulmakla uğraşmak zorunda kalmadan, düzgün biçimlendirilmiş yazdırılabilir bir görünüm örneği verilmiştir. BBC News sitesi, özel bir başlık ile tamamlanan, yazdırılacak makaleleri düzgün bir şekilde biçimlendirir. Baskı görünümünde yorumları içerirler, ancak yine de iyi yapılmış bir iştir.
Aynı şeyi yapan pek çok başka site var. Örneğin ArsTechnica ve… sitemiz, ancak hepsinin ekran görüntülerini göstermek aptalca olurdu. Araştırmamızda, onları doğru şekilde uygulayan siteler çok az ve çok uzak.
Özetlemek gerekirse… lütfen sitenize bir baskı stil sayfası uygulamak için gereken 5 dakikanızı ayırın!